''Bloody Pit of Horror'' is the twelfth studio album by Gwar. It was released on November 9, 2010, on Metal Blade Records. The first track, "Zombies, March!" is now available for streaming at Bloody-Disgusting's website. This is the last album to feature longtime character Flattus Maximus before Cory Smoot's death and Flattus' retirement. This album does not have a coinciding movie.
